General information
The Research Ethics Office is responsible for:
- Supporting the procedures for the ethical review of research;
- Maintaining records of all research projects involving ethical review;
- Providing advice on all matters concerning research ethics.
Office functions
- To arrange meetings of the Senate Research Ethics Committee, to prepare valid and completed applications and to advise applicants of the ethical opinions reached by the Committee.
- To maintain records of ethical opinions given by any recognized Research Ethics Committee on any research project for which a member of the University is responsible
- To liaise with the University Procurement Office concerning insurance arrangements for relevant research projects.
- To provide advice and guidance on the preparation of applications for ethical review, and on good ethical practice in research.
- To play a lead role in developing research ethics policy and procedures, and encouraging good ethical practices and processes.
- To conduct training and awareness sessions across the University in research ethics.
